What symptoms do people with brain malformations usually have?

4 doctors weighed in across 2 answers

Varied: There are many different types of brain malformations, thus the symptom complex is varied. Some common symptoms are seizures, developmental delay, failure to thrive, language delay, blindness, etc. The list goes on and is dependent on the areas of the brain affected by the malformations.

All kinds: A brain malformation is a general term for some part of the brain that did not develop correctly. For every part of the brain there can be a malformation and the symptoms of each one would be different depending on the part of the brain effected. Some would have no symptoms.
